I recently sat down to install shelf liner in the cabinet under the bathroom sink. It was looking sad in there, and even though noone sees it but me, I wanted to freshen it up. The escutcheon plates around the water pipes looked like they were 100 years old; they were silver metal that barely snapped together and were well rusted over from bathroom humidity. I ordered these to complete my project. They were super easy to install, and I actually like the fact that they are plastic, i.e, no rust. The holes are a bit large for my pipes but they do lend a finished look. The 3M tape stuck well to the liner. No complaints here. Would absolutely repurchase. ðŸ‘
